Basal slip of a screw dislocations in hexagonal titanium
Abstract
Basal slip of a screw dislocations in hexagonal closed-packed titanium is investigated with ab initio calculations. We show that a basal dissociation is highly unstable and reconfigures to other structures dissociated in a first order pyramidal plane. The obtained mechanism for basal slip corresponds to the migration of the partial dislocations and of the associated stacking fault ribbon in a direction perpendicular to the dissocia-tion plane. Presented results indicate that both basal and pyramidal slip will operate through the Peierls mechanism of double-kink nucleation and will be equally active at high enough temperature.
